Africa is a vast and diverse continent with a wide range of climates and habitats. When planning your holiday this fact is important to keep in mind, as the time of year you decide to go to a particular destination will dictate the quality and quantity of wildlife that you will likely be able to see whilst you are there. What’s your best advice for someone travelling to Africa?
My best advice would be, when you come to Africa make sure that you don’t just see everything through your camera lens or through binoculars. There are so many incredible things to see in Africa that you will constantly want to photography, but I think it is also equally important to make sure that you soak in every sight, smell, and sound engaging all your senses. Photographs are surely great to have, but some of the memories will ultimately last forever in your lifetime and are best absorbed when you do nothing other than registering them in your Soul and in your Mind!
